QUOTE(SA-914 @ Mar 9 2015, 04:47 AM)
For all you Towers out there...
I got a renmetal towbar...first time towed the vehicle, it towed well.
Second time, I could not get the wheels to track, so I tied off the steering wheel. Nothing changed in the 4 days between tows.
Anybody experience this and maybe put some dead load in the front trunk?
Check everything the front of the 914, including the tires. When the alignment's off, or something loose in the front that lets the alignment change, strange things happen. Once it was just unusually wide wheels in front. Sound familiar? Usually it's only at very low speeds and once you get past ten or fifteen miles an hour it stops. Well, it's always stopped for me, but who knows? Fixing the 914's alignment or front suspension also fixes it for towing.
